First off, great job on most things as I'm sure everyone else will let you know.However there is always room for improvement in anything, so how bout some constructive critisism ;0 hey?
Swimming needs work, it's way too fast and the animations just don't feel right the way it currently looks set up.
The fighting itself looks like it needs work as well. Half the time it looked like the 2 people were just standing there throwing mad glares back and forth hoping one would die before the other one from lack of utter exustion before the other one or something.
More/better animations for what I'm assuming were magical spells could possibily fix this. Just alot of people standing around with lights coming from them seems more like a firework show than it does an intense battle to the death fight. And seeing as though fighting is a core aspect of an rpg I'd say this is a fairly large issue that still needs special attention.
But again take what you will and leave the rest after all it's only MY opinion.
Edit: After once again watching the videos yet another suggestion to help the fighting might be to speed up alot of the actions maybe at double the speed they are now or something. That way it looks like you actually want to hit something trying to kill you instead of standing around 3/4 of the time admiring how deathly nasty it looks. "My goodness that's a large axe you hav...".
It's almost as if there is no normal attack filler animation. As in you literally just wait for each special move to power back up so you can hit at all and until that point your character just stands there.
So perhaps add in a normal attack animation that loops every so many seconds that gets interupted by your special attacks when they're powered back up and ready to use. This would increase the action of the fight and bring a more engaged feel to it in my opinion.
Also maybe if your character is getting a spell ready to cast you can have a fill animation showing him powering up the spell before releasing it.
Look at World of Warcraft and how the fighting and magic casting is done in it after all that will be one of the games you'll be competeing against seeing as though they look to be the same type of game:
